🌞 Light & Placement
Thrives in bright, indirect light but tolerates some light shade. Avoid harsh direct sun, which can scorch the leaves. Ideal near east or west-facing windows with filtered light.
💧 Water & Humidity
Water when the top 3–5 cm of soil are dry. Loves moderate to high humidity; mist occasionally, especially during winter heating, to keep fronds lush and tips green.
🪴 Soil & Potting
Plant in a well-draining indoor palm mix rich in organic matter. Repot every 2–3 years in spring to refresh soil and accommodate its expanding root system.
🐾 Toxicity & Safety
Non-toxic to pets and humans—safe for homes with cats, dogs, and children.
🌱 Growth & Propagation
Moderate grower indoors. Propagation is done via seed or division, but division is uncommon for home growers due to dense clumping roots.
📆 Seasonal & Special Care
Wipe fronds gently to remove dust and keep them photosynthesising efficiently. Fertilise monthly during spring and summer with a balanced liquid fertiliser diluted to half strength.
🐛 Common Issues
Brown leaf tips often indicate low humidity or fluoride sensitivity; use filtered water if needed. Watch for spider mites or mealybugs and treat promptly with neem oil.
🧬 Botanical Background
Dypsis lutescens, also known as Areca Palm or Butterfly Palm, is native to Madagascar and belongs to the Arecaceae family. Its elegant fronds and pet-safe nature make it a timeless favourite for European indoor jungles.
